Citigroup - New York, NY

posted about 1 month ago

Full-time - Senior
New York, NY
Credit Intermediation and Related Activities

About the position

The Generative AI Common Platform Engineer Lead role at Citi is a strategic position aimed at building a green-field development platform for Generative AI. This position requires a hands-on engineering leader who will be a founding member of the team, responsible for addressing large-scale engineering challenges both on-premise and in the cloud. The role emphasizes the use of cutting-edge LLMs to meet user needs across the bank, and involves active coding and mentoring of other engineers.

Responsibilities

  • Design and build high-quality, highly reliable software.
  • Partner closely with other development teams, quants, and subject-matter experts in our businesses.
  • Ensure software platforms comply with Citi's security and SDLC processes.
  • Run the platform at scale and continue innovating and evolving.
  • Mentor and nurture other engineers to help them grow their skills and expertise.

Requirements

  • Proven experience as an Engineering thought leader, hands-on Software Engineering Manager, or similar role.
  • Strong knowledge of AI/ML, particularly LLMs, and eagerness to apply this rapidly changing technology.
  • Deep experience in Python programming.
  • Strong distributed systems skills and knowledge.
  • Strong system architecture skills.
  • Experience in building and running a large platform at scale.
  • Knowledge of Go, Java, or other modern programming languages.
  • Good knowledge of Kubernetes, Kafka, and RESTful design.
  • Development experience with at least one public cloud provider.
  • Knowledge of functional languages is a distinct advantage.

Benefits

  • Medical, dental & vision coverage
  • 401(k)
  • Life, accident, and disability insurance
  • Wellness programs
  • Paid time off packages including vacation, sick leave, and paid holidays
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service